Boron carbide (B4C) is without doubt one of the toughest male-manufactured materials used in numerous fields. It is the third most difficult chemical compound, position right after diamond and cubic boron nitride (components CBN). Boron carbide can be a dim black crystal, so it's also known as a “black diamond”. This powerful material won't exist in character, and could only be obtained from boron and carbon within a furnace. Boron carbide can be formed by pressing at temperatures exceeding 2000 as a result of its hardness and various exclusive Qualities, boron carbide has significant purposes in a number of industries.

Boron carbide is really a large-temperature p-kind semiconductor. Depending on the doping, the material reveals a superior diploma of electrothermal resistance and in combination with graphite, it’s utilized to be a thermocouple at around 2,three hundred °C.

"Boron carbide" is for that reason a loved ones of compounds of different compositions, in lieu of only one compound. B₁₂(CBC) = B₆.₅C is a common intermediate that approximates a frequently identified ingredient ratio. The crystal symmetry on the B₄C composition plus the nonmetallic electrical character from the B₁₃C₂ compositions are each based on configurational dysfunction among boron and carbon atoms at diverse positions from the crystal, Based on quantum mechanical calculations.

Boron carbide was initially synthesized by Henri Moissan in 1899,[7] by reduction of boron trioxide both with carbon or magnesium in existence of carbon in An electrical arc furnace.
